1) Easily Change Your iPad Password

Are you looking for an easy way to update your iPad’s password? Then you’ve come to the right place! With just a few steps, you’ll be able to change your iPad password in no time.

Let’s get started:

  • Open the Settings app: You can find the settings icon on your iPad’s home screen.
  • Choose Touch ID & Passcode: Scroll down and select the Touch ID & Passcode option.
  • Enter your current password: To change your iPad password, you’ll first need to enter your current password.
  • Type in a new password: Create a new password by entering it twice. Make sure that the second password matches the first one.
  • Confirm your changes: Once you have entered the new password, confirm your changes to save the settings.

That’s it! You successfully changed your iPad password. Keep in mind that setting a strong, unique password is the best way to ensure that your iPad remains secure.

Q: How can I change my current passcode?

A: You can change your current passcode by going to Settings > Face ID & Passcode on your device and entering your current passcode. From there, you can select “Change Passcode” and set a new passcode.

Q: Can I use lowercase letters in my passcode?

A: Yes, you can use lowercase letters in your passcode for added security. This can be done by selecting a custom alphanumeric passcode when setting up your device passcode.

Q: Is it possible to have a passcode with letters and numbers?

A: Yes, you can create a passcode with both letters and numbers for added security. This can be done by selecting a custom alphanumeric passcode when setting up your device passcode.

Q: What is the default passcode requirement for Apple devices?

A: The default passcode requirement for Apple devices is a six-digit numeric code. However, you can customize this to a four-digit numeric code, custom alphanumeric code, or other preferred passcode type in your device settings.
